Output ec847667171935a05ad6f4bd835e2f6f8f067a5a604e0aed80098fabc8a1ba79:1

value
33125
script pubkey
OP_0 OP_PUSHBYTES_20 51f427abaadde7fce6ffcf182a0b5e9ea595f918
address
bc1q286z02a2mhnleehleuvz5z67n6jet7gcq08xhk
transaction
ec847667171935a05ad6f4bd835e2f6f8f067a5a604e0aed80098fabc8a1ba79
confirmations
19902
spent
false